[dpdk-dev] [PATCH v2 4/7] net/mlx5: e-switch VXLAN netlink routines update

Yongseok Koh yskoh at mellanox.com
Tue Oct 23 12:07:08 CEST 2018


On Mon, Oct 15, 2018 at 02:13:32PM +0000, Viacheslav Ovsiienko wrote:
> This part of patchset updates Netlink exchange routine. Message
> sequence numbers became not random ones, the multipart reply messages
> are supported, not propagating errors to the following socket calls,
> Netlink replies buffer size is increased to MNL_SOCKET_BUFFER_SIZE
> and now is preallocated at context creation time instead of stack
> usage. This update is needed to support Netlink query operations.
